Product Manager, Consumer Experience

2 months ago


New York, New York, United States Uber Full time
About The Role


As a Product Manager on Uber's Grocery and Retail team, you will be responsible for driving the consumer adoption and growth for our fast-moving Grocery and Retail business, helping customers "Get Anything" they want from local merchants.


Uber to date has successfully helped customers get restaurant food delivered to their doors and we are very excited to bring that delight and convenience to virtually everything else.

Today, we're focused on the grocery, convenience, alcohol and pharmacy verticals, but this team has broader ambitions to expand into plenty of other retail areas in the future.


In this role, you will be working with a broad set of cross-functional stakeholders across operations, data science, design, engineering, marketing and more by developing and implementing innovative approaches to acquire and retain customers, increase order frequency, and optimize user experience and engagement.

What The Candidate Will Do

  • Refine the product definition, strategy and long term vision for delivering a best-in-class Get Anything" platform.
  • Execute on the roadmap, partnering with key stakeholders across the company to ensure we're delivering impactful and high quality consumer experiences that drive business results.
  • Design and build scalable solutions that can serve all consumer intents and use cases across different verticals (e.g. grocery, retail, pharmacy, etc.)
  • Drive the cross-functional team (engineering, analytics, Ops, etc.) to deliver on qualitative objectives and quantitative goals for the business.
  • Leverage data and experimentation to drive growth and optimize product performance.
  • Communicate the product plans, benefits and results to key stakeholders including the Regional Operations and leadership teams.
Basic Qualifications

  • 5+ years of Product Management experience delivering successful and innovative consumer facing products with your fingerprints all over them. You should be familiar with systems thinking, analytics and experiment design, and have a solid understanding of software development processes and concepts.
  •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ills. You will be doing a lot of internal and external advocacy and collaboration that will require a keen eye for narrative and storytelling about your product area.
  • Research and data-driven mindset. Experience in defining objectives and key results (OKRs) and tracking key performance indicators (KPIs) to achieve them. You find a way to get the data you need and whip it into an insightful story with no help. You know how to leverage this data to make decisions without getting stuck in analysis paralysis.
  • Customer obsession. You have a knack for taking on complex product challenges and finding elegant solutions that make our users and partners jobs delightfully simple.
  • A Driver" mindset. You are biased toward action, a great collaborator, a master disambiguator/simplifier, and constantly pushing toward clarity and delivery. You never hesitate to roll up your sleeves and tackle something hands-on.
  • A high bar across the board - from your own contributions to the people you work with, to the products you work on, you have a never-ending desire to grow and learn.
Preferred Qualifications

  • Entrepreneurial experience building and leading businesses, including ownership and optimization of business performance metrics.
  • Growth experience with a track record of delivering highly successful and innovative 0-to-1 products.
  • A Computer Science, Statistics, or Engineering undergraduate degree or equivalent, preferably including hands-on design or software development experience.
  • A true passion for Uber's mission, our products, and the company's hybrid technology/operations nature.


For New York, NY-based roles: The base salary range for this role is USD$149,000 per year - USD$165,500 per year.

For San Francisco, CA-based roles: The base salary range for this role is USD$149,000 per year - USD$165,500 per year.

For all US locations, you will be eligible to participate in Uber's bonus program, and may be offered an equity award & other types of comp.
